Jesikah Suggs Dies: ‘My Life With The Walter Boys’ Writer-Producer Was 32

Jesikah Suggs, a writer-producer of Netflix’s My Life With The Walter Boys, died at her home in Studio City, California, on Tuesday, August 18, following an eight-year battle with breast cancer.
